摘要
文章首先介绍汽车零部件电磁兼容测试现状及发展趋势,随后具体阐述电动助力转向系统(EPS)的工作原理,并对EPS电磁兼容测试项目、测试方法、以及具体的测试工况选择等方面进行分析,最后总结出适合EPS的试验方法。
This paper introduces the current status and future trend of automotive electromagnetic compatibility test firstly,then introduce the EPS working principle, and make detailed analysis on the EPS EMC test items, test methods and test mode. At the end of article, a summary of EPS EMC test proposal is summed up.
